Want to squeeze more dough from your budget? Groceries can consume a large chunk of your earnings, but with some savvy strategies, you can whittle that expense down. First, make a detailed meal plan for the week and stick to it. This helps stop impulse buys at the store. Next, turn yourself into a coupon hunting master. Check newspapers, online sites, and even your local store's website for savings opportunities.

Before you hit to the supermarket, browse your pantry and fridge. This exposes what you already have, helping you build a shopping list that avoids unnecessary acquisitions.

Look for deals between different brands and choose store-brand goods which are often just as good but cost less. And don't forget to include the overall cost per unit, not just the sticker price. When it comes to produce, opt for seasonal produce which are usually more inexpensive. Ultimately, a little planning and smart thinking can markedly reduce your grocery bill, leaving you with more cash to spend on the things that truly count.

Master Your Budget with These Savings Secrets

Tired of feeling stressed about money? Worried that your outlays are getting out of control? You're not alone! Many people have a hard time with budgeting, but it doesn't have to be a pain. With a few simple tricks, you can control your budget and reach your budgeting goals.

Here are some hacks to help you reduce money:

* Track Your Spending

Begin by recognizing where your money is going. Employ a budgeting app, spreadsheet, or even a simple notebook to keep of every buy.

* Create a Budget

Once you know how much money you're spending, you can design a budget that works your desires. Assign your income to essential outlays first, then consider your desires.

* Identify Areas to Cut Back

Review for areas where you can reduce your outlays. Can you negotiate lower prices on utilities? Are there any memberships you're not using?

* Set Financial Targets

Setting financial goals can help you stay motivated. What are you saving for? A new car? Retirement? Understanding your goals will make it easier to stick to your budget.
